图像增强是通过数学变换有目的地调整图像特征以提升模型泛化能力,核心是在语义不变前提下扩大样本多样性,涵盖几何、色彩、噪声及高级方法,并需注意医学、文字等任务的特殊约束。

图像增强不是简单地调亮或加噪,而是通过数学变换有目的地调整图像的视觉特征或底层表示,让模型更容易学到关键模式。核心在于:保持语义不变的前提下,扩大有效样本多样性。
图像本质是二维(或多维)数值矩阵,每个像素是0–255的整数或0.0–1.0的浮点数。增强操作即对这个矩阵施加可逆/不可逆的确定性或随机性变换:
用OpenCV + NumPy即可完成大多数基础增强,适合理解原理或嵌入边缘设备。关键点:统一输入为uint8数组,注意边界处理和数据类型转换。
实际项目中别把所有增强写成一个函数。推荐三层结构:
立即学习“Python免费学习笔记(深入)”;
不是越花哨越好。以下情况要谨慎:
基本上就这些。原理吃透后,写几行NumPy就能搭出可用的增强流水线;重点不在代码多炫,而在每步变换是否服务于任务目标。
以上就是Python编写图像增强算法的原理与项目实现思路【教程】的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号